Output deb20e61e8f0473825305fce5974786a4976cc28830f16f180da6227ca4d5d50:0

value
651661
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7c13d2b4ff9de1f7a0ccb066bc6585f505c06594 OP_EQUAL
address
3D15TfMUa5XXuPPD85Zcv7Kg4hQ8XNRFB2
transaction
deb20e61e8f0473825305fce5974786a4976cc28830f16f180da6227ca4d5d50
spent
true